​Available in 2025: Are you a High School student looking to complete your community hours? Do you have a son or daughter playing in CMLA and want to share in the fun? Have you played lacrosse in the past and would like to give back to your community?
We have many opportunities to get involved regardless of experience level:
-
Assisting with our softLAX and paperweight programs, this is a perfect opportunity for high school students
-
Coaching a house league program, great for CMLA Alumni
-
Game day HL helper aka. "door opener", parents this one is for you!
​
What you will get out of the program:
-
Opportunity to complete 40+ hours of community service
-
Ability to use the club as a professional reference
-
Eligible to request a reference letter from the club
-
Opportunity to obtain your NCCP coaching certification
​
​
We are looking for people who are:
-
Great working with small children
-
Compassionate, flexible and good team players
-
Responsible, dependable and punctual
-
Interested in coaching in the future
​
What are the requirements?
-
Volunteers must be at least 14 years old or older
-
Volunteers are required to commit to the same time each week for the duration of the program. House league typically runs from April-June with most teams having 2 time slots per week.
Once you have submitted your application, we will contact you to confirm your availability.

Volunteers
All adult volunteers (turned 18 prior to January 1, 2021) with the Clarington Minor Lacrosse Association are required to have a valid Vulnerable Sector Check issued within the past 12 months to volunteer with our association. You will be required to provide a copy to the CMLA Privacy Officer prior to any program participation. A volunteer letter can be provided to receive a discounted price through DRPS (as per Feb 2022, processing time is 5-6 weeks). The Ontario Lacrosse Association has also partnered with Sterling Backcheck to offer an alternate option to obtain your Vulnerable Sector Check, this option is online only and typically you have your form back in 24-48 hours.
